A deepening investigation into the Coldcard hardware wallet incident has substantially widened the estimated impact. Galaxy Research's forensic work identified nearly 1,200 addresses that experienced losses totaling 1,082.65 Bitcoin—a figure that translates to approximately $70 million at current valuations. What makes this analysis particularly significant is the compressed timeframe in which these funds moved: a mere 41-minute window suggests either an automated exploit or a coordinated extraction, raising fresh questions about the initial attack vector.

The Coldcard hardware wallet, long regarded as among the most security-conscious options for self-custodial Bitcoin storage, has faced scrutiny before around firmware updates and supply chain vulnerabilities. However, this incident appears distinct in both scale and execution. The concentration of losses across so many addresses within such a tight temporal window indicates either a vulnerability in Coldcard's firmware that enabled bulk account compromise, or a supply chain compromise affecting a batch of devices. Hardware wallets theoretically isolate private keys from internet-connected systems, so a breach of this magnitude demands explanation about how attackers circumvented that fundamental design principle without requiring physical access to each device.

Galaxy's research methodology—tracing blockchain transactions to identify affected addresses—represents standard forensic practice in cryptocurrency investigations, yet the findings underscore a broader tension in the hardware wallet ecosystem. While these devices remain exponentially more secure than hot wallets or centralized exchanges, they are not immune to sophisticated attacks. Firmware vulnerabilities, supply chain interdiction, or even social engineering attacks targeting recovery phrases remain possible vectors. The Coldcard team has been notified and is investigating, though communication has been limited. For affected users, the immediate question centers on whether their devices remain compromised or whether the initial exploit has been fully patched.

This incident will likely accelerate conversations around multi-signature custody models, hardware wallet diversification, and more rigorous firmware audit standards across the industry. The $70 million figure—while substantial—remains relatively modest compared to major exchange collapses or smart contract exploits, but its significance lies in what it reveals about assumptions surrounding hardware wallet invulnerability.
